Why Traditional Tracking Fails After 45

Most beginners who join CFP Weight Loss come to me after years of failed diets and scale obsession. The scale lies, especially when hormonal changes during perimenopause and menopause shift body composition. You can lose fat, gain muscle, reduce inflammation, and still see the same number. That's why my approach in The CFP Method focuses on measurable markers that actually reflect health improvements for those managing diabetes, blood pressure, and joint pain.

Essential Metrics to Track Weekly

Start simple. Track body measurements at navel, hips, chest, and thighs every two weeks using the same tape measure and time of day. These often show 1-3 inches lost in the first month even when scale weight stalls. Next, monitor fasting blood glucose and blood pressure readings. Many clients see systolic pressure drop 8-12 points within 8 weeks of consistent movement.

For joint-friendly progress, record your mobility scores. Can you now touch your toes without pain? How many flights of stairs can you climb before needing to rest? These functional measures matter more than gym weights when osteoarthritis or old injuries limit you. I also recommend tracking daily step counts and perceived energy levels on a 1-10 scale. Beginners often move from 4/10 energy to 7/10 within six weeks.

Non-Scale Victories That Matter Most

In my 20 years coaching middle-income adults 45-54, the real game-changers are the non-scale victories. Notice if your clothes fit differently, if you can play with grandkids without knee pain, or if you no longer need afternoon naps. Track waist-to-hip ratio—aim to get it under 0.85 for women and 0.9 for men to reduce diabetes risk significantly.

Use a simple journal or free phone app to log three things: movement minutes, hunger levels before/after meals, and sleep quality. This data reveals patterns insurance won't cover but that transform your results. My method emphasizes consistency over intensity—20-30 minute walks most days beat sporadic intense workouts that leave you too sore to continue.

How to Measure Progress Without Overwhelm

Every Sunday, review your weekly averages. Celebrate when fasting glucose drops 10 points or when you can walk 30 minutes without stopping. Progress photos taken in the same lighting every 4 weeks provide visual proof when the mirror lies. Remember, sustainable loss after 45 averages 0.5-1 pound weekly when combining strength, mobility, and nutrition timing.
